India's Slowdown "Deeper And Longer Than Anticipated," Says Moody's: Report
Low chance of sustained growth at or above 8% for India, says Moody's
Moody's projects budget deficit of 3.7% of GDP in 2019-20
Downgrade puts additional pressure on authorities to kickstart economy
Moody's Investors Service cut India's credit rating outlook to negative, citing a litany of problems from a worsening shadow banking crunch and a prolonged slowdown in the economy to rising public debt.
